Finance Review Summary — Brindlecore Plus Tier

To heads of department: the new Brindlecore Plus subscription tier launched on schedule. Uptake at 6% of active base, above forecast. ARPU up 11%; churn flat. Support costs slightly elevated due to onboarding queries. Margin impact positive from month two. Pricing holds through Q3; no discounting authorised. Full model refresh due next cycle. Direction for the tier's expansion is set out in the note below.

internal memo for yaduf-fahap: The board signed off on a budget of $4.5 million for Project Ralix. The renewal with Eliokox Freight closes at $63.8 million a year, 9 percent below the last contract.

Present: D. Okafell (chair), R. Vintner, S. Calloway. For the sales leads.

We walked through the draft franchise deal with Brindlehart Foods covering the Aster Valley territory. Royalty tiers look workable; R. Vintner flagged the exclusivity clause as too generous and will push back. Training obligations land on our side for year one, so budget accordingly. Target signing is end of next month, assuming legal clears the termination terms. What follows is the confidential bit on our plans.

confidential, yahip-hagug: Gorixax Logistics plans to lower the Ulaael list price by 26.6 percent in October. The pricing group signed off on a budget of $199.9 million for Project Holix. The renewal with Kasdorox Systems closes at $137.5 million a year, 8.2 percent above the last contract. Project Lamion slips by a full year because of the audit delay.

## Changelog — ProctorLane queue defaults changed

As of this release, the exam-proctoring queue in VigilDesk no longer retries stalled sessions indefinitely. Default retry count dropped, visibility timeout increased, and dead-letter routing is on by default. If pages fire overnight, check the dead-letter depth before restarting workers. The new default configuration values are shown below.

service settings:
[casax]
port = 6379
team = rusir
host = casax.zemvarhq.corp
region = outer-4
access_code = ac_9808ce
timeout_ms = 1500